- This fascinating filmed "Master Class" showcases the events surrounding 1930s movie star Jeanette MacDonald being featured on a brand new Fall 1952 reality television series, "This is Your Life." Without either the show's host or the TV audience knowing it, the live show served as a personal reunion for MacDonald and her movie co-star Nelson Eddy. They made 8 films together and were off-screen lovers despite marriages to others. But by late 1952 Jeanette and Nelson were estranged both personally and professionally. Jeanette's reactions during the half-hour show are telling, first her nervousness that "he" might actually be there, her looking around trying to acting nonchalant, relaxing when someone else comes onstage - not "him," then sitting tensely once again in anticipation and finally crying when Nelson makes his appearance and holds her hand through the rest of the show. How the show came about and its poignant aftermath was written by Madeline Bayless. The talk was delivered by Linda Tolman. After the show Nelson's appearance is shown again, silent, in slow motion and then with still photos. Anyone who believes these two didn't love each other off-screen should study the footage and the expressions that flit across Jeanette's face as she tries both to hide her girlish adoration of him, and to regain her composure.
